blocks.h moved to config.h

This commit is contained in:
Luke Smith 2020-03-01 07:01:56 -05:00
parent 6bd2e845be
commit b9e29ebe90
No known key found for this signature in database
GPG key ID: 4C50B54A911F6252
3 changed files with 9 additions and 7 deletions

View file

@ -1,7 +1,7 @@
output: dwmblocks.o output: dwmblocks.o
gcc dwmblocks.o -lX11 -o dwmblocks gcc dwmblocks.o -lX11 -o dwmblocks
dwmblocks.o: dwmblocks.c blocks.h dwmblocks.o: dwmblocks.c config.h
gcc -c -lX11 dwmblocks.c gcc -c -lX11 dwmblocks.c
clean: clean:
rm *.o *.gch dwmblocks rm *.o *.gch dwmblocks
install: output install: output

View file

@ -4,8 +4,10 @@ static const Block blocks[] = {
/* {"", "cat /tmp/recordingicon", 0, 9}, */ /* {"", "cat /tmp/recordingicon", 0, 9}, */
/* {"", "music", 0, 11}, */ /* {"", "music", 0, 11}, */
{"", "pacpackages", 0, 8}, {"", "pacpackages", 0, 8},
{"", "crypto", 0, 13},
{"", "torrent", 20, 7}, {"", "torrent", 20, 7},
{"", "news", 0, 6}, {"", "news", 0, 6},
/* {"", "moonphase", 18000, 5}, */
{"", "weather", 18000, 5}, {"", "weather", 18000, 5},
{"", "mailbox", 180, 12}, {"", "mailbox", 180, 12},
{"", "volume", 0, 10}, {"", "volume", 0, 10},

View file

@ -25,7 +25,7 @@ void sighandler(int signum);
void termhandler(int signum); void termhandler(int signum);
#include "blocks.h" #include "config.h"
static Display *dpy; static Display *dpy;
static int screen; static int screen;
@ -69,7 +69,7 @@ void getcmds(int time)
{ {
const Block* current; const Block* current;
for(int i = 0; i < LENGTH(blocks); i++) for(int i = 0; i < LENGTH(blocks); i++)
{ {
current = blocks + i; current = blocks + i;
if ((current->interval != 0 && time % current->interval == 0) || time == -1) if ((current->interval != 0 && time % current->interval == 0) || time == -1)
getcmd(current,statusbar[i]); getcmd(current,statusbar[i]);
@ -90,7 +90,7 @@ void getsigcmds(int signal)
void setupsignals() void setupsignals()
{ {
for(int i = 0; i < LENGTH(blocks); i++) for(int i = 0; i < LENGTH(blocks); i++)
{ {
if (blocks[i].signal > 0) if (blocks[i].signal > 0)
signal(SIGRTMIN+blocks[i].signal, sighandler); signal(SIGRTMIN+blocks[i].signal, sighandler);
} }
@ -101,7 +101,7 @@ void getstatus(char *str)
{ {
int j = 0; int j = 0;
for(int i = 0; i < LENGTH(blocks); j+=strlen(statusbar[i++])) for(int i = 0; i < LENGTH(blocks); j+=strlen(statusbar[i++]))
{ {
strcpy(str + j, statusbar[i]); strcpy(str + j, statusbar[i]);
} }
str[--j] = '\0'; str[--j] = '\0';
@ -157,7 +157,7 @@ void termhandler(int signum)
int main(int argc, char** argv) int main(int argc, char** argv)
{ {
for(int i = 0; i < argc; i++) for(int i = 0; i < argc; i++)
{ {
if (!strcmp("-d",argv[i])) if (!strcmp("-d",argv[i]))
delim = argv[++i][0]; delim = argv[++i][0];
} }